Do we really need more bishops in the vein of Weakland and Sklba?Anonymousnoreply@blogger.comtag:blogger.com,1999:blog-4531248303954963098.post-68536989978293859062013-12-19T23:38:02.279-06:002013-12-19T23:38:02.279-06:00Many over simplify (and vilify) these two men; thi...Many over simplify (and vilify) these two men; this reductionist attitude of Burke/Conservative = Good; Wuerl/Moderate = bad is really misses the complexity and particular talents of these two men. Cardinal Burke is an ardent defender of the faith; Cardinal Wuerl might have different pastoral gifts. If you read some of his quotes regarding communion reception, it is very clear that he does not approve of the decisions of certain politicians, but that addressing their public scandal should be the duty of their local bishop. Furthermore, while Cardinal Burke tries to defend the Eucharist from descecration through unworthy acceptance, Cardinal Wuerl seeks to prevent the Eucharist from being politicized. We have a beautiful tradition of being a both/and Church.
